    Driving through Northport and I saw Barb's out of the corner of my eye. It sounded familiar so I asked my fella to pull over as I pondered. Then I remembered it was an honorable mention on MLive's best doughnuts in the state piece. So, naturally I had to try them. We were there on a Wednesday so it wasn't that busy. Apparently on the weekends the doughnuts go by 10am but there were plenty to be had by 2pm that day. We got one of each available--a glazed pretzel shaped doughnut, glazed cake, chocolate glazed cake, and custard filled with chocolate. A few we got two of (because, why not?) and it came to about $5. The doughnuts were fab. The best I've ever had? Probably not. But pretty good. I'm more of a yeast glazed doughnut kinda gal and the pretzel shaped doughnut here was fab. Sizable (seriously huge) and melted in my mouth. The cake had a great flavor and was nice and dense. Maybe a little on the drier side but that's to be expected with cake vs. yeast. The glazes were also fab and the custard in the custard filled was excellent. The space is small and decorated a bit like a cross behind an antique store and a tea shop. A few benches out front to sit at once you have your goodies but generally no where to sit. Cash only.
